Exaile-cn 100721
Exaile-cn是一个对 Exaile进行扩展的项目,通过对Exaile进行扩展,使Exaile功能上更加丰富,更加符合中国用户的使用习惯,给国内Linuxer提供一个更加本土化的播放器。感谢 BillMa 来稿!
更新说明
- 增加豆瓣电台插件
- 改进歌词滚动显示
- 支持歌词文件名的自定义
- 支持调整歌词行距
- 支持exaile0.3.2
安装方法 注意:Exaile-cn现在只支持Exaile0.3.2.0,如果你的Exaile不是0.3.2.0,可能会无法正常使用。
先运行whereis exaile,查找exaile的位置,下面假设exaile位于/usr/lib/exaile/下:
- 解决乱码问题方法:将id3.py覆盖到/usr/lib/exaile/xl/metadata目录下(需要 root权限)
- 豆瓣封面插件安装方法:将doubancovers复制到~/.local/share/exaile/plugins/(如果没有目录,先创建目录)下,然后启动exaile,选中插件选项即可
- 歌词同步显示插件安装方法:先把engineunified.py 和engine_normal.py覆盖到/usr/lib/exaile/xl/player,再将LyricDisp目录复制到~/.local/share/exaile/plugins下,然后启动Exaile,选中插件选项即可
- 面板标签竖行显示:将init.py覆盖到/usr/lib/exaile/xlgui/目录下(需要root 权限)
- 豆瓣电台插件安装方法:将track.py覆盖到/usr/lib/exaile/xl/trax/目录下(需要 root权限),将doubanfm复制到~/.local/share/exaile/plugins/,启动exaile,选中插件选项,然后在Douban.FM插件的设置里面填写用户名和密码,重启exaile,在文件菜单里面会显示豆瓣电台列表
Read More:
再次感谢 BillMa 来稿!最近 Toy 兄不知去向,我在忙毕业设计,业界方面似乎有意将重头戏放在两周后的 LinuxCON ,新闻更新慢了,各位请见谅~
马兄,这个安装方式不太优雅啊。。。
這個項目非常好啊!!!支持
问一下,exaile cn采取的id3 编码识别方式和amarok的id3编码识别方式有何区别? 发现exaile cn的mp3编码识别要好于amarok
@Sunng: 恩恩……可是目前还没有想到一个好的安装方法啊
@wangping: exaile的id3编码读写用的是mutagen,而amarok用的是taglib,taglib的效果应该比mutagen好才对啊
@Billma: 支持!最近在用amarok不过还是更喜欢exaile。不过豆瓣获取封面的功能我几十G的歌几乎找不到多少。可能我听歌太偏了……………………………………………………
@黑日白月: Toy兄常年间歇性失踪………………
不会装……
@billma 我有一个mp3文件夹,部分歌曲是gbk编码,部分是utf8,实验下来时exaile读取出id3编码正常,而amarok部分少部分歌曲乱码...
@wangping: 你开了amarok的编码自动检测吗? 我开之后就没遇到过乱码
不如直接给出命令让我们复制粘贴……
在用exaile 0.3.1的弟兄们使用doubanfm可以从这里获得 http://github.com/sunng87/exaile-doubanfm-plugin/downloads
@Sunng: exaile0.3.2对插件的改动主要是在设置方面,其余的倒是不太大,另外那个trax.track现在不允许subclass了,所以我对exaile里的trax.track文件进行了修改
@Billma: exaile太恶心了,从0.3.0到0.3.1到0.3.2各个版本插件都不兼容,三个小升级跟着插件通通得改,还互不兼容
貌似gui不错 弄下来安装试下 让我对象听歌应该够了
@ihipop 编码检测肯定打开啊,不开编码自动检测的话,mp3在amarok里全部乱码。
当然,可能与我的mp3编码混乱有关,部分歌曲转过utf8编码,但是又有很多下载的mp3没转码
@wangping: ……不知道amarok是怎么检测编码的,exaile-cn的补丁实际上就是依次把utf8、gb2312、big5是一个遍,实际上很弱智的
debian lenny现在是不是没有办法使用exaile 0.3.2?
@Billma: Amorok要考虑的编码种类比较多,结果检测准确性反而被拖累了,如果只考虑那三种编码,还是Exaile-cn的准确性比较高,当然,遇到这之外的编码它就SB了
好像豆瓣插件有些问题
@Billma: 报告bug,豆瓣fm会error…………
@kidfruit:是不是这个错误信息Failed to retrieve playlist, try again.
@kidfruit: 如果是Failed to retrieve playlist, try again.请看看 http://code.google.com/p/exaile-cn/issues/detail?id=16 这儿
@Billma: 好。我试试。
@kidfruit: 你个Otaku听的歌自然偏了……谁有能力写个Amazon JP的插件吧……
@Petty: 囧好吧我确实是otaku o(╯□╰)o
@kidfruit: 又不是什么丢人的事,囧什么,我至少也算个Animer
说实话,比起Douban,从Amazon上抓肯定要强的多,除了水印
@Petty: exiale 0.3.1开始支持cover providers排序,可以在选项里设置